Istanbul:
Turkish protesters on Saturday refused to evacuate an Istanbul park despite a concession by Prime Minister Recep Tayyip Erdogan to halt the site's redevelopment, in a potential escalation of two weeks of anti-government unrest.
"We will continue our resistance in the face of any injustice and unfairness taking place in our country," the Taksim Solidarity group, seen as most representative of the protesters, said in a statement after all-night discussions with campers in Gezi Park.
